Effective Digital Marketing Strategies for Nonprofits
Let’s delve into how your nonprofit can utilize digital marketing effectively.
1. Harnessing Social Media Engagement
Social media platforms such as Facebook, Instagram, and Twitter offer powerful avenues for nonprofits to showcase their cause and engage with potential volunteers. Here are actionable steps:
Content Creation: Use visuals to engage your audience. Tools like Canva can help you create stunning graphics and videos that tell your nonprofit's story.
Engagement: Actively respond to comments and messages. Tools such as Sprout Social can help manage your posts and interactions effectively.
2. Implementing Email Campaigns
Email marketing remains one of the most effective tools for nonprofit volunteer recruitment.
Segmentation: Divide your mailing list into segments and personalize content. Personalized emails deliver six times higher transaction rates compared to non-personalized communications, making a case for tailored messaging.
Storytelling: Use engaging narratives in your emails. Highlight stories of current volunteers and how their engagement has been impactful.
3. Adopting SEO Strategies
Optimizing your nonprofit's website and content with relevant keywords can enhance visibility:
Keyword Research: Tools such as Google Keyword Planner and SEMrush can help identify high-traffic searching phrases related to volunteering and community service.
Content Optimization: Ensure your website features relevant keywords in the titles, headings, and throughout the content.
4. Utilizing Analytics for Growth
Data-driven decisions can amplify your outreach:
Tracking Conversions: Use tools like Google Analytics to monitor volunteer sign-ups from various marketing channels. Setting up conversion goals aids in measuring campaign effectiveness.
Identifying Issues: Track metrics like bounce rates and conversion rates to continuously refine your approaches.
5. Fostering Community Engagement
Creating a supportive community can enhance volunteer retention:
Platforms: Utilize Facebook Groups or Slack channels to create a sense of belonging among volunteers. This can enhance ongoing relationships.
Example: Organizations like Crisis Text Line successfully build community dynamics among volunteers, facilitating valuable connections and ongoing engagement.
6. Running Engagement Campaigns
Digital marketing campaigns that resonate with potential volunteers can significantly impact engagement:
- #GivingTuesday: This worldwide movement showcases how nonprofits can promote volunteer opportunities alongside fundraising efforts. This dual approach can drive higher participation rates.
7. Collaborating with Influencers
Engaging with local influencers can expand your reach:
Influencer Partnerships: Collaborate with local personalities who share your mission. Their audience can broaden your reach and attract new volunteers.
Impact Measurement: Track the success of these campaigns through engagement metrics.
Case Studies: Success Stories of Nonprofits
Feeding America's Transformation
After implementing a targeted marketing strategy that focused on storytelling through social media, Feeding America saw a 30% increase in volunteer sign-ups. By sharing testimonial videos from current volunteers, they effectively illustrated the impact individuals could have by joining their cause.
The Nature Conservancy's Email Engagement
The Nature Conservancy took a data-driven approach by segmenting their email lists and sending personalized communication to past volunteers. As a result, they achieved a 40% increase in volunteer event attendance, showcasing the power of tailored outreach.
